LS-HDB5 Hydrostatic Density Balance System (5000 g / 0.1 g) is a hydrostatic density balance system for immersed weighing, aggregate relative density, specific gravity, and absorption workflows under ASTM C127, ASTM C128, AASHTO T84, AASHTO T85, EN 1097-6. The balance capacity, fixture tare, basket, vessel, suspension, drainage, specimen size, readability, and calibration scope are configured together.
What is LS-HDB5 Hydrostatic Density Balance System (5000 g / 0.1 g) used for?
LS-HDB5 Hydrostatic Density Balance System (5000 g / 0.1 g) is used for hydrostatic density weighing workflows in civil engineering materials laboratories, quality control labs, research programs, and construction material acceptance testing.
Which standards does LS-HDB5 support?
LS-HDB5 supports ASTM C127, ASTM C128, AASHTO T84, AASHTO T85, EN 1097-6. Lithostek can also configure reporting fields, accessories, and calibration documents around local project or laboratory requirements.
